When drafting a letter to seek permission from the HR manager to study while working, it's essential to maintain clarity, politeness, and professionalism. Begin by addressing the HR manager formally, state the reference or application number, and specify the duration for which permission is sought. Emphasize the commitment to maintain work performance and invite any queries or concerns. Conclude the letter with a polite closing and signature.
Permission Letter to HR Manager for Study While Working
From,
Human Resource Manager,
__________ (Name),
__________ (Name of the Company),
__________ (Address)
Date: __/__/____ (Date)
To,
__________ (Name of the Employee),
__________ (Designation)
Subject: Permission to study while working
Sir/Madam,
This letter is in response to the reference number/application number __________ (Reference Number/Application Number). We would like to bring in your kind notice that your application is accepted for study while working at this firm starting from ________ (Date) to ________ (Date).
Kindly make sure that your work at the firm is not compromised. Else our deal will be terminated and you will not be able to study while working. If you have any queries regarding this, please feel free to contact me.
Sincerely,
__________ (Signature)
__________ (Name),
__________ (Designation / Human Resource Manager),
__________ (Name of the Company)
